I'm wondering where the five minutes came from? What's the deal with that?I don't know shit about soccer. That's some stupid rule?

ha, I laughed when you first asked, "Someone knows nothing about soccer"...

During each half the ref has a watch, whenever someone: scores, kicks the ball far out of bounds, gets injured,... anything that stops the game, he is supposed to turn the watch on and turn it off when play resumes... when the end of the game comes he adds THAT (whatever the total time amounted to) time to the end of the game... it's called stoppage time.

It's intent is to prevent teams from scoring one goal and just faking injury after injury purposely wasting time.
